Jakhli Population - Nagaur, Rajasthan
Jakhli is a large village located in Makrana Tehsil of Nagaur district, Rajasthan with total 793 families residing. The Jakhli village has population of 4366 of which 2282 are males while 2084 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Jakhli village population of children with age 0-6 is 608 which makes up 13.93 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Jakhli village is 913 which is lower than Rajasthan state average of 928. Child Sex Ratio for the Jakhli as per census is 773, lower than Rajasthan average of 888.
Jakhli village has higher literacy rate compared to Rajasthan. In 2011, literacy rate of Jakhli village was 67.08 % compared to 66.11 % of Rajasthan. In Jakhli Male literacy stands at 79.06 % while female literacy rate was 54.32 %.

Jakhli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 793 | - | - |
Population | 4,366 | 2,282 | 2,084 |
Child (0-6) | 608 | 343 | 265 |
Schedule Caste | 1,027 | 539 | 488 |
Schedule Tribe | 7 | 5 | 2 |
Literacy | 67.08 % | 79.06 % | 54.32 % |
Total Workers | 1,339 | 1,063 | 276 |
Main Worker | 820 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 519 | 286 | 233 |
